Saint Joseph’s RC Junior, Infant and Nursery School governors are seeking a dedicated Site Manager to join our warm and welcoming community. Embracing our Catholic ethos, we value respect, care, and community spirit.

 

Key Responsibilities:

  • Oversee the maintenance and security of our school premises
  • Act as a keyholder, ensuring the school is safe and secure
  • Manage contractors and maintenance staff
  • Perform cleaning duties and oversee the regular cleaning staff to maintain a high standard of cleanliness
  • Undertake maintenance duties as required
  • Uphold health and safety standards

 

Key Qualities:

  • Good IT competencies, demonstrating proficiency in managing digital systems and tools essential for the role
  • Be professional at all times and be a team player
  • Be positive, inspirational and self-motivated
  • Be able to organise and carry out various maintenance duties and repairs to ensure the general up keep and maintenance of the premises

 

Qualifications:

  • Experience in facilities management or a similar role
  • Strong understanding of health and safety regulations
